On Mon, May 26, 2025 at 04:50:11PM +0530, Manivannan Sadhasivam wrote:
> On Mon, May 26, 2025 at 10:42:40AM +0000, Samiksha Garg wrote:
> > Some vendor drivers need to write their own `msi_init` while
> > still utilizing `dw_pcie_allocate_domains` method to allocate
> > IRQ domains. Export the function for this purpose.
> > 
> 
> NAK. Symbols should have atleast one upstream user to be exported. We do not
> export symbols for random vendor drivers, sorry.
> 
> - Mani
